摘要
In this work, pure and La3+-doped PBN56 ceramics (La3+ added from 0 wt% to 4 wt%) were fabricated and studied concerning its structure, microstructure and dielectric properties. The analysis of the microstructure of the ceramics showed a change of the grain morphology for ceramics with La content higher than 1.0 wt%. X-ray diffraction and Raman spectroscopy were performed to study the structure of the PBN56 ceramics. The results showed the presence of an orthorhombic phase, whose concentration is increased with the increasing of the La3+ content. The analysis of the results was performed to investigate the presence of the orthorhombic phase and the composition where its formation begins.
